vimarsana.com
Home
Shop Inc The
Top Locations Tagged with Shop inc the
Shop inc the in United states - 80301/ near boulder/Furniture near boulder
1.The Artisan Shop, Inc, Salina, CO
Shop inc the in India - / near lucknow
2.Numbers Shop Inc The Lucknow On Canada
Shop inc the in United states - 44406/ near mahoning
3.Sound Shop Inc The, Boardman Canfield Rd